前言
预测分析在当前的大数据时代变得越来越重要,它可以帮助企业从历史数据中识别模式,并预测未来的趋势。为了提高预测的准确性,有必要选择合适的预测分析模型。本文将介绍常见的预测分析模型,并探讨其优缺点以及适用场景。
常见的预测分析模型
- 回归模型:回归模型通过拟合历史数据中的自变量和因变量之间的关系来构建预测方程。常见的回归模型包括:
- 线性回归
- 多元回归
- 非线性回归(例如,多项式回归、对数回归)
- 时间序列模型:时间序列模型专注于预测时间序列数据的未来值。常见的模型包括:
- 自动回归移动平均(ARMA)模型
- 自动回归综合移动平均(ARIMA)模型
- 季节性自回归综合移动平均(SARIMA)模型
- 分类模型:分类模型将数据点分类到预定义的类别中。常见的模型包括:
- 逻辑回归
- 决策树
- 支持向量机(SVM)
- 聚类模型:聚类模型将数据点分组到不同的簇中,每个簇中的数据点具有相似的特征。常见的模型包括:
- K-均值聚类
- 层次聚类
- 谱聚类
- 神经网络模型:神经网络模型是由相互连接的节点组成的复杂非线性模型,能够学习复杂的关系和模式。常见的模型包括:
- 前馈神经网络
- 卷积神经网络(CNN)
- 循环神经网络(RNN)
选择模型的准则
选择合适的预测分析模型取决于以下因素:
- 数据类型:数据可能是数值型、分类型或时间序列型。
- 目标变量:目标变量可以是连续的(回归模型)或离散的(分类模型)。
- 数据复杂性:数据可能包含噪声、异常值或非线性关系。
- 预测时间范围:需要预测短期的还是长期的趋势。
- 可解释性:模型的结果是否需要易于理解和解释。
结论
选择合适的预测分析模型对于准确预测至关重要。企业可以通过考虑数据类型、目标变量、数据复杂性、预测时间范围和可解释性等因素,找到最适合其特定需求的模型。通过利用这些模型,企业可以从数据中获得有价值的见解,并做出明智的决策。
问答
Q1:哪些模型适用于预测时间序列数据?
A1:时间序列模型,如 ARMA、ARIMA 和 SARIMA。
Q2:哪种模型最适合分类问题?
A2:分类模型,如逻辑回归、决策树和 SVM。
Q3:神经网络模型有哪些优势?
A3:学习复杂关系、处理非线性数据、在大型数据集上表现良好。
Q4:如何选择回归模型的类型?
A4:根据数据的线性度,选择线性回归、多元回归或非线性回归。
Q5:聚类模型在哪些场景中很有用?
原创文章,作者:诸葛武凡,如若转载,请注明出处:https://www.wanglitou.cn/article_72150.html